#567787 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#567787 is composed of 33.7% red, 46.7%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.3% cyan, 11.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 199.6 degrees, a saturation of 22.2% and a lightness of 43.3%. #567787 color hex could be obtained by blending #aceeff with #00000f.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#567787 color description : Mostly desaturated dark blue.
#567787 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#567787 has RGB values of R:86, G:119, B:135 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0.12,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 5666695.

Shades and Tints of #567787
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020303 is the darkest color, while #f6f8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#567787
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#677176 is the less saturated color, while #0194dc is the most saturated one.
